Other requirements
General requirements
- Completed online application to TCU Graduate Studies and the School of Music
- Two official transcripts of all college work. Translations must be provided for all international transcripts
- Non-refundable application fees will be charged for both the TCU application and the School of Music application
- Three current letters of reference from persons qualified to comment on the applicant's academic and/or musical achievement, teaching and/or professional experience, and potential for success in the degree program
- A double-spaced typed paper of five pages or more that illustrates the applicant's writing and research skills.
- A curriculum vitae is required. This should include a list of concert performances, compositions, publications, and other musical accomplishments
- Test scores must be sent to TCU from the testing agency: GRE (composition only) and TOEFL or IELTS (international students)
